Road to Housing Act: Brokered Deposit Reforms Offer Long-Awaited Clarity for Community Banks
The Road to Housing Act takes aim at one of the most persistent pain points in community banking: the risk that everyday deposit relationships — particularly those involving custodial arrangements and reciprocal deposit networks — get swept into the regulatory definition of “brokered deposits.” Sections 901 and 902 of the legislation offer meaningful, targeted relief, providing both structural clarity for institutions that rely on payment services arrangements and expanded safe harbors for...
